Amy Heath (b. 1974, San Francisco) came to London to study art at 18. She holds a BA (Hons) in Painting from Chelsea College of Art (1994–97) and an MA in Drawing from Wimbledon School of Art (2001–03). Her practice spans painting, works on paper, and illustration, rooted in magical realism, feminism, and imaginative storytelling about the female experience. She served as artist's model for Dame Paula Rego (1998–99) — a formative experience that profoundly influenced her approach. She is a member of the Society of Women Artists and has exhibited at their Annual Open Exhibitions (2022–2025). She was longlisted for the VAA Professional Artist's Award (2023) and shortlisted for the Women in Art Prize (2025).
